Bell Canada Enterprises is hiring a Specialist, Marketing to elevate Bell Media’s presence with agencies and advertisers and drive inbound demand. This role converts Bell Media’s offerings into clear, compelling positioning and storytelling to grow awareness and engagement.
What You'll Do
- Plan and execute integrated trade marketing campaigns to strengthen Bell Media’s visibility with agencies, advertisers, and industry stakeholders.
- Build clear, differentiated positioning and messaging frameworks for key solutions and programming initiatives.
- Develop market-facing content and creative such as case studies, one-pagers, videos, ad units, articles, and PowerPoint presentations.
- Lead digital programs across web, email, and social channels like LinkedIn to reach and engage priority B2B audiences.
- Manage always-on and campaign-based initiatives that drive measurable outcomes including reach, engagement, qualified traffic, and conversions.
- Coordinate targeting, flighting, creative rotations, and optimization to improve cost efficiency and quality of engagement.
- Partner with web and analytics teams to improve site pathways, page content, and conversion points like contact forms and content downloads.
- Ensure all content and pages adhere to brand standards, accessibility, and SEO best practices.
- Translate insights into actionable optimizations and recommend next steps to increase performance and ROI.
- Build editorial calendars aligned to priority verticals, audiences, and tentpole moments such as upfronts and programming launches.
- Create and repurpose thought leadership to support market education and category leadership.
- Coordinate with internal stakeholders and external partners to amplify content across owned and paid channels.
- Plan and execute Bell Media’s presence at key B2B industry events, sponsorships, and speaking opportunities to elevate brand visibility.
- Deliver cohesive, on-brand experiences across booth presence, creative assets, session content, and pre/post-event amplification.
- Manage timelines, logistics, creative development, and post-event performance reviews.
